Connection avec Speedtouch 330

Samixsx -  
 samixsx -
Voila j'ai une debian sarge sur un pc avec un kernel 2.6 et tout ce qu'il faut, mon modem est detecter (speedtouch 330 silver (thomson)) je chage les modules, je lance le firmware (sa initialise la ligne (ok)), je configure tous les fichiers qu'il faut et quand je fait
pppd call adsl
il me reponde cela mais tres rapidement :
Plugin pppoatm.so loaded
PPPoATM plugin_init
PPPoATM setdevname-remove unwanted option
PPPoATM setdevname_pppoatm
SUCCESS: 8.35
Ensuite il me rend la main et me laisse comme sa, sans jamais me connecter ???
Si vous auriez de l'aide concernant cela merci d'avance.

2 réponses

kmf
 
Je ne connais pas ton modem en detail, donc je ne peux rien dire sur les messages d'erreures que ta eu. Ca peut etre un vrai probleme ou seulement un probleme de mauvais parametres, mauvaises options.

Cependant je me demande pourquoi tu fais directment appel au daemon pppd pour demarrer la connection (c'est ecrit dans une doc, tuto, laquelle ou lequel ?).
En general c'est une tres mauvaise idee car il faut y mettre exactement les bonnes options et pas seulement dans la ligne de commande mais aussi dans les fichiers dans /etc/ppp/... . Et souvent le driver a besoin de ces propres fichiers de config en plus.

En principe il faut passer par les utilitaires prevus pour ca, dans l'ordre de preference:

------------
1) Celui du systeme, "yast" dans ton cas. Il faut creer une connection de type adsl (eventuellement avec ppp). C'est certainement un autre menu que celui pour les cartes reseau. La on mets tous les parametres notamment les identifiants.

-------------
2) Celui qui vient avec ton driver. Par exemple pour celui de speedtouch:
http://speedtouch.sourceforge.net/
ils expliquent dans le fichier INSTALL (dans le paquet tar) a la fin:
(d'ailleur: tu as pris ce driver ??)

4. Setup

In every case, you will need the following information:
- your vpi
- your vci
- your ISP login
- your ISP password

4.1 PPPoA connection on GNU/Linux

copy SpeedTouch330_firmware_3012.zip to /etc/speedtouch/
speedtouch-setup

4.2 PPPoE connection on GNU/Linux

copy SpeedTouch330_firmware_3012.zip to /etc/speedtouch/
speedtouch-setup --pppoe

....
5. Start the connection

- manually with speedtouch-start
- automatically : plug the modem (requires hotplug)

5. Stop the connection

- manually with speedtouch-stop
- automatically : unplug the modem (in this last case, your provider
may not see immediately that you have been disconnected and prohibit
further connection for a small period of time).


Donc il y a de scripts speedtouch-setup, speedtouch-start, speetouch-stop qui font les bonnes choses pour toi (si ce n'est pas automatique de toute facon). C'est le script speedtouch-start qui est sense de demarrer le pppd.

------------
3.) On peut eventuellement aussi passer par le paquet rpppoe (installe en Suse ou disponible sur les cds) qui fait pppoe pour le ppp avec ethernet. Ca peut aussi marcher en usb car les drivers usb creent souvent de devices ethX (X=0,1,2,...) pour de cartes reseau virtuelles. La aussi il y a de scripts de configurations, demarrages, stop. (cherches rpppoe sur google pour trouver la page home de ce paquet avec la doc etc.)
Mais bien sur 1.) et surtout 2.) sont preferables a ca. Par contre les scripts de rpppoe sont toujours preferables a un appelle directe: "pppd ...."
0
Samixsx
 
Mais moi je n'est pas suse, mais debian sarge kernel 2.6.8, et sous kde 3.3, je ne voit pas ou est le truc pour configurer sa connection, mais l'erreur vien pas de la.
0
kmf
 
Desolee j'avais ton ancien poste en tete. De toute facon s'il n'y a rien en Debian pour ca tu passes a la methode 2.
0
samixsx
 
Moi j'ai le speedtouch 330 de chez thomson le gris, pas la raie, et puis j'ai installer les driver et tout le blabla en suivant un howto dans /usr/share/doc. Maintenant quand je lance pppd call adsl, sa me rend lamain de suite sans rien dire, ifconfig ppp0 detail bien (a la fin TX bytes ou un truc comme sa (les deux sont a 0)), et quand je fais un
plog -f
sa marque comme si sa lancé la connection et ensuite sa me met
sent [LCP ConfReq id=0x5 <asyncmap><magic.....
cette phrase sans arret et puis au bout de 5/6 phrases sa marque
connection terminated
tcflush Input/outpout error
Voila je deséspère car j'ai essailler les tuto manuel d'a peu pres tous le monde, les config auto avec des question et lors du lancement sa me repond toujours la phrase precedente que j'ai marqué.
Si quelqu'un a une idée merci.
0